Skin side up. In nearly every basket-style air fryer the heating element and fan sit above the food, so the hottest, driest and fastest-moving air strikes whatever faces the top of the drawer. Skin that faces up sits directly in that airflow, loses surface moisture quickly and browns; skin that faces down rests against a perforated basket in its own rendered fat, where it tends to steam rather than crisp, and where it is far more likely to stick and tear when you lift the piece out. The one sensible exception is the opening stage of a longer cook on thick bone-in pieces or a whole bird, where a few minutes skin side down lets fat begin to render and helps the denser underside catch up. Even then the piece should finish skin side up, because the last stretch of the cook is what decides how the skin turns out.
Why the airflow, not the recipe, decides it
An air fryer is a small convection oven with an aggressive fan. In the common drawer or basket design, that fan and the element are mounted in the lid, and air is pushed down over the food, through the perforations and back up around the sides. The surface facing up therefore gets the most direct heat and, more importantly, the most air movement. Crisp skin is mostly a moisture problem: the surface has to dry out before it can brown properly, and moving air is what carries that moisture away.
The downward-facing surface has the opposite conditions. Fat renders out of the skin, runs downward and collects around the contact points, and any liquid that pools there keeps the surface at roughly the temperature of simmering liquid instead of letting it dry. That side will still cook, and it will often take on colour from direct contact with the hot basket, but it is browning by conduction in fat rather than crisping in air. The result is usually darker in patches and softer overall.
Oven-style air fryers with wire racks change the picture slightly but not the conclusion. Air can circulate underneath a rack, so the down side fares better than it does in a solid-bottom basket, and the difference between the two sides shrinks. The element is still above, though, so the upward face keeps the advantage. If your model has multiple rack positions, the higher position gives more top heat and faster skin colour, and the lower position is gentler if the skin is darkening before the meat is done.

When starting skin side down actually helps
Starting skin down is worth considering when the underside is much thicker than the top, or when there is a lot of fat under the skin that needs time to render. Bone-in thighs and leg quarters are the classic case: the bone side is dense, sits closest to the basket and benefits from early contact heat, while the fat layer under the skin softens and begins to run rather than sitting as a rubbery layer beneath a crisp surface.
Treat it as a first stage, not a whole method. A reasonable approach is to give roughly the first third to the first half of the cooking time skin down, then turn and let the skin face up for everything that remains. The final stretch needs to be long enough for the skin to dry out again after being turned, which is why finishing skin down almost always disappoints even when the piece is cooked through.
For anything thin, quick or already lean, skip the manoeuvre entirely. A boneless thigh or a small piece of skin-on breast can be done before the flip has paid for itself, and every turn is another chance to tear the skin.
- Worth it: thick bone-in thighs, leg quarters, whole chicken, anything with a heavy fat layer.
- Not worth it: boneless pieces, thin cutlets, anything that cooks in a short time.
- Rule of thumb: skin down for the earlier part, skin up for the longer finish.
Cut by cut
The general principle bends a little depending on the shape of what you are cooking and how evenly heat can reach it.
- Bone-in thighs: start skin down if you like, but finish skin up for the majority of the time. This is the cut where the two-stage approach makes the biggest difference.
- Drumsticks: they are round, so no side stays down for long. Turn them once or twice so no single face sits against the basket the whole time.
- Wings: forget up and down. Shake or toss the basket a couple of times so the pieces redistribute and every surface gets exposure.
- Skin-on breast: skin up the whole way. The breast dries out easily, and repeated handling costs more than the underside gains.
- Leg quarters and half chickens: skin up, arranged so the thickest part sits toward the outside of the basket where airflow is strongest.
- Whole small chicken: breast down first, then turn breast up for the remainder, so the breast is not exposed to the hardest heat for the entire cook.
- Skin-on chicken pieces cooked with sauce or glaze: skin up and glaze late, since sugar in a glaze burns quickly under direct top heat.
Things that matter more than which side faces up
Orientation is worth getting right, but several other habits have a larger effect on whether the skin comes out crisp. The most common one is surface moisture. Chicken straight from a package or a marinade carries a film of liquid that has to be driven off before browning can begin, so patting the skin thoroughly dry with paper towel is the cheapest improvement available. Salting the skin and letting the pieces sit uncovered in the refrigerator for a few hours draws out more moisture still, and the skin will look visibly drier and tighter before it goes in.
Crowding is the second one. An air fryer works because air moves, and a basket packed edge to edge turns into a steam chamber. Pieces should sit in a single layer with visible gaps between them, and it is better to run two batches than to squeeze one. If pieces are touching, the contact points will be pale and soft no matter which way the skin faces.
A very light film of oil helps conduct heat across the skin and encourages even colour, but chicken skin already contains plenty of fat, so more oil is not better. Lining the basket completely with parchment or foil is worth avoiding as well, since it blocks the perforations that the airflow depends on and traps rendered fat directly under the food. If you use a liner for easier cleanup, choose a perforated one and let the food hold it down.
- Pat the skin dry before seasoning, and salt ahead of time if you have the chance.
- Single layer, gaps between pieces, two batches instead of one crowded one.
- A thin film of oil, not a coating.
- Do not seal the basket floor with a solid liner.
- Preheat if your model allows it, so the skin starts drying immediately.
Flipping without tearing the skin
Skin that has been sitting against a hot basket will often be stuck when you first go to move it. Give it a moment rather than forcing it: as fat renders and the surface sets, a stuck piece usually releases on its own. Slide a thin spatula flat underneath rather than pulling upward with tongs, and use tongs only to steady the piece. A fork through the skin lets moisture and fat escape and leaves an obvious soft spot.
One turn is usually enough for flat cuts. Round cuts like drumsticks benefit from two. Beyond that you are mostly losing heat every time the drawer comes out, and each opening drops the temperature inside and interrupts the drying that crisping depends on. If pieces near the edge are colouring faster than those in the middle, swap their positions during a turn you were making anyway instead of adding an extra one.
- Let stuck skin release itself instead of pulling it free.
- Lift with a thin spatula from underneath; steady with tongs.
- One turn for flat cuts, two for round ones, and rearrange rather than re-turn.
Judging doneness, and rescuing pale skin
Colour is not doneness. An instant-read thermometer in the thickest part, kept clear of the bone, is the only reliable check. The widely used safe minimum for poultry is 165°F (74°C), and many cooks deliberately take thighs and drumsticks further, to somewhere around 175 to 185°F (80 to 85°C), because dark meat becomes more tender rather than drier as the connective tissue breaks down. Breast meat is best pulled as soon as it reaches the safe minimum.
If the meat is done but the skin is still pale, the usual causes are a crowded basket, damp skin at the start, or too low a temperature. The fix in the moment is a short finish at a higher setting with the skin facing up and the pieces spread out, watched closely, since skin goes from golden to burnt quickly under direct top heat. If the opposite happens and the skin darkens while the inside is undercooked, the temperature is too high for the thickness of the cut: drop it, and consider moving the food to a lower rack position in an oven-style model.
Let the chicken rest a few minutes before serving, but rest it on a rack rather than a plate. Skin placed on a flat surface sits in the juices that run out and softens on the underside within minutes, which undoes the thing you spent the whole cook working toward.
- Check with a thermometer in the thickest part, away from the bone.
- 165°F (74°C) is the safe minimum; dark meat is often taken higher for texture.
- Pale skin plus cooked meat: short, closely watched finish at a higher setting, skin up.
- Dark skin plus raw interior: lower the temperature, or use a lower rack position.
- Rest on a rack, not on a plate.

Do I have to flip chicken in an air fryer at all?
Not always. Flat cuts placed skin side up in a single layer can be left alone for the whole cook, and the skin will usually be better for it. Turning is most useful for thick bone-in pieces, where an early stage skin side down helps render fat and cook the dense underside, and for round cuts like drumsticks and wings, which have no natural top side. If you do turn, plan on once for flat cuts and finish skin side up.
Why is the underside of my chicken soggy even though the top is crisp?
Because the down side is not really being air fried. It sits against the basket in rendered fat and released juices, so its surface stays wet and cannot dry out enough to brown properly. A perforated liner or a small rack that lifts the pieces off the basket floor helps, as does not overcrowding, since juices pool faster when pieces touch. Turning the piece once so the underside gets some time in the airflow also evens things out.
Should a whole chicken go breast up or breast down in an air fryer?
Start breast down and finish breast up. The breast is the part most likely to dry out, so it benefits from spending the earlier part of the cook away from the hardest top heat, and the flip gives the skin time to dry and colour before serving. Check the temperature in the thickest part of the thigh as well as the breast, since the two are done at different points.
Does parchment or foil change which side should face up?
It does not change the answer, but a solid liner makes the down side noticeably worse. Blocking the perforations cuts off the airflow underneath and traps rendered fat directly beneath the food, so anything facing down effectively cooks in a shallow pool of grease. If you want easier cleanup, use a perforated liner, keep it under the food so it cannot lift into the fan, and still place the skin facing up.
Skin up or down when the chicken is coated in a sauce or marinade?
Skin up, and apply anything sugary late. Sauces and glazes containing sugar or honey darken quickly in direct top heat, so brushing them on during the last few minutes gives colour without scorching. A wet marinade should be wiped off the skin before cooking, since the extra surface moisture has to evaporate before browning can start at all.
